Student-centered coaching is about providing opportunities for a coach and teachers to work in partnership to (1) set specific targets for students that are rooted in the standards and (2) work collaboratively to ensure that the targets are met. During student-centered coaching, teachers and coaches analyze student work to gauge students' progress toward one or more specific learning targets.
